We’re not afraid to play the '60s, '70s and '80s hits you rarely, if ever, hear on the radio anymore. Having worked in the business for many years, I know how it goes... You run a very tight playlist, and generally rotate the same ‘safe’ songs over and over again. It’s how it works in most commercial radio markets around the world, and is understandable, with every minute listened generating much needed revenue for the stations. Online radio is different. We don’t have to play it as safe, with less regulation, and much lower overheads.
